Jakub pointed out that a some of our source files have inconsistent.
He also produced the attached document that visualize the different
indentation styles in our code ("Tttttttt" is one tab and "s" is a
space).
So would anyone object if I sed s/\t/ /g'ed our code (with
manual fixup where needed). It could (and probably will) give issues
applying any existing patches (on the BTS).
Patches in the BTS should be a big issue. You just need to remember to
do the same transformation on them before applying. :)
If we're going to do a mass indentation fix and take the hit for that, it
would be tempting to standardize on an identation level as well. I think
we have some files that are using an eight-space indent.
Yes, a few files have a "cperl-indent-level: 8" declaration. On the
other hand, some of them have also contradictory "vim: ts=4"
declaration. :(
Personally I'd prefer 4*space indentation everywhere. I could live with
tabs, but tabs mixed with spaces make me cringe.
